House raising services involve elevating a residential property to address various structural or environmental concerns. The process typically includes lifting the entire building off its foundation, often with specialized equipment, to create space beneath the structure. Once elevated, contractors may repair or replace the foundation, improve drainage systems, or make other modifications before lowering the house back onto its new, higher foundation. This service is often tailored to meet the specific needs of each property, ensuring the home is securely supported at an increased height.

This service helps solve problems related to flooding, water damage, and moisture intrusion, especially in areas prone to heavy rains or rising water levels. Raising a house can protect the property from future flood risks by elevating it above potential flood zones or flood plains. Additionally, it can address issues caused by unstable or deteriorating foundations, providing a stable platform that enhances the property's safety and longevity. House raising can also create additional usable space underneath the home for storage or future construction projects.

Properties that typically utilize house raising services include older homes with foundations that have become compromised over time, as well as new constructions in flood-prone regions. Homes situated in low-lying areas or near bodies of water often benefit from elevation to mitigate flood damage. Commercial buildings and structures with basements that flood frequently may also be candidates for raising. The service is suitable for a variety of property types, including single-family residences, multi-family units, and small commercial structures that require elevation to meet local codes or protect against environmental hazards.

Cost Range - House raising services typically cost between $20,000 and $100,000 depending on the property's size and complexity. For example, raising a small single-family home may be around $30,000, while larger or more complex projects can exceed $80,000.

Factors Affecting Cost - Costs vary based on foundation type, structural modifications, and local labor rates. Additional expenses may include permits, utilities, and foundation repairs, which can add several thousand dollars to the total.

Average Pricing - On average, homeowners in Will County, IL, can expect to pay roughly $40,000 to $70,000 for house raising services. This range reflects typical project sizes and local market conditions.

Cost Considerations - It is important to obtain detailed estimates from local service providers to understand the specific costs for individual properties. Costs may fluctuate depending on the home's height, foundation type, and site accessibility.

Actual totals will depend on details like access to the work area, the scope of the project, and the materials selected, so use these as general starting points rather than exact figures.
